Is It Just For The Experienced?

Nope, not at all. Across the 200 French resorts, you’ll find slopes and opportunities for every type of skier imaginable. You’ll have a great time here whether this is your first time skiing or your one hundredth. It could even be a brilliant place to get those skiing lessons that you’ve always wanted. There are plenty of instructors and guides operating around this area who could provide the expertise that you need.

What’s The Best Place To Ski?

Ah, now that’s a different question. You can return to the place where it all began. Home of the 1924 winter Olympics, Chamonix is a world-renowned ski resort and is incredibly popular. It’s thriving too with everything from races to festivals in a truly captivating location. You’ll even find theme parks here as well so it could definitely be a trip worth taking.

Or, consider visiting Courchevel. Perfect for serious skiers it’s not an exaggeration to say that this location provides one of the greatest international ski experiences. Head here, and you’ll be amazed and astounding with the sheer drops and exciting courses that await you. Did we mention it is also breathtakingly beautiful?
